steve: It's the Doppler Effect - it changes the effective frequency of the signal if you move towards or away from the transmitter at great speed.
The COFDM system used by DAB consists of 1000+ sub-carries - at extreme speed these become distorted and unrecoverable.

deano1113: The card provides access to encrypted channels you pay for.

You can view free-to-air HD channels without any card. To view the others you need a subscription card in an HD box, with a HD subscription payment attached to the card.
